tire size calculator tacoma world Formula and Mathematical Explanation

Calculating tire dimensions involves converting metric widths to imperial inches. The tire size calculator tacoma world follows this logic:

  1. Sidewall Height: (Width × Aspect Ratio) / 100. This result is in millimeters.
  2. Total Diameter: ((Sidewall Height × 2) / 25.4) + Wheel Diameter. We multiply by 2 because there is a sidewall above and below the rim.
  3. Circumference: Diameter × π (3.14159).
  4. Revs Per Mile: 63,360 / Circumference.
Variable Meaning Unit Typical Range
Width Section width of the tire Millimeters (mm) 215 – 315
Aspect Ratio Height as % of width Percentage (%) 55 – 85
Rim Size Wheel diameter Inches (in) 15 – 20

Practical Examples (Real-World Use Cases)

Example 1: The “Standard” Upgrade

Many 3rd Gen Tacoma owners use the tire size calculator tacoma world to move from 265/65R17 to 265/70R17.
Input: Stock (265/65/17), New (265/70/17).
Output: The diameter increases from 30.6″ to 31.6″. This provides a 0.5″ lift to the differential without changing the width, meaning no rubbing on the UCA.

Example 2: Moving to 33-inch Tires

A user wants to install 285/75R16 tires on a 2nd Gen Tacoma. Using the tire size calculator tacoma world, they see the diameter jumps to 32.8″. The speedometer will show 60 MPH when the truck is actually traveling at 64.3 MPH. This indicates that regearing for larger tires might be necessary to maintain torque.

Key Factors That Affect tire size calculator tacoma world Results

While the math is precise, real-world factors influence how these numbers translate to your Tacoma:

  • Actual Tire Dimensions: A “33-inch” tire from Brand A might be 32.6″, while Brand B is 33.2″. Always check the manufacturer’s spec sheet after using the tire size calculator tacoma world.
  • Wheel Offset: If your new wheels have a deep negative offset, even a small tire might rub the fender flare. Check our Tacoma wheel offset explained guide.
  • Suspension Sag: Older Tacomas with worn leaf springs will have less clearance than the tire size calculator tacoma world assumes for a “stock” truck.
  • Weight: Heavy E-rated tires increase unsprung weight, significantly impacting Tacoma gas mileage tips.
  • Tread Depth: A brand-new mud terrain tire can be nearly an inch taller than the same tire at the end of its life.
  • PSI: Lowering tire pressure for off-roading reduces the effective rolling radius, changing the speedo error temporarily.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I fit 285/75R16 tires without a lift?
Generally, no. On a Tacoma, 285s will rub the body mount and the front plastics without a 2-3 inch lift and likely some fender trimming tutorial work.
Will a tire size calculator tacoma world help with fuel economy?
Indirectly. By knowing the diameter increase, you can calculate the loss of effective gear ratio, which explains why your MPG drops after an upgrade.
How do I fix the speedometer error?
You can use a device like a Hypertech Speedometer Calibrator to plug into your dash and correct the signal based on the tire size calculator tacoma world output.
What is the largest tire for a stock Tacoma?
Most owners find that 265/75R16 or 265/70R17 is the largest “no-rub” size for a factory suspension.
Is a 285 tire always a 33?
Close, but not exactly. A 285/75R16 is 32.8″, while a 285/70R17 is 32.7″. Both are colloquially called 33s.
Does width affect clearance more than height?
On Tacomas, width often causes rubbing on the Upper Control Arm, while height causes rubbing on the frame and fender liners.
Do I need to change my spare tire?
Yes! If you use the tire size calculator tacoma world to upgrade your main tires, your spare must be the same diameter to avoid damaging your differential.
How does tire weight affect braking?
Larger tires from the tire size calculator tacoma world have more rotational inertia, meaning your brakes have to work harder to stop the truck.
